GM Certified Service Technician

Job in Canal Winchester, Fairfield County, Ohio, 43110, USA
Listing for: Jeff Wyler Automotive Family
Full Time position
Listed on 2026-06-22
Job specializations:
  • Trades / Skilled Labor
    Automotive Technician, Heavy Equipment Mechanic
Salary/Wage Range or Industry Benchmark: 60000 - 80000 USD Yearly USD 60000.00 80000.00 YEAR
Job Description & How to Apply Below
Position: GM Certified Service Technician - Sign On Bonus!
Location: Canal Winchester

Location:

Canal Winchester, OH 43110

Job Title:

Certified GM Technician

Benefits
  • Top dollar pay for certified technicians
  • Clean, well-equipped shop
  • Climate-controlled facility
  • Medical, dental, vision, 401(k), and more benefits
  • Paid time off; paid holidays
  • Employee discounts on parts, service and vehicle purchases
  • Ongoing GM training and advancement opportunities
  • Leadership team that supports technicians
  • Culture values your time, talent, and contribution
Responsibilities
  • Perform advanced diagnostics, repairs, and maintenance on GM vehicles to manufacturer standards.
  • Utilize the latest tools, technology, and service information to deliver accurate and efficient results.
  • Work closely with Service Advisors and Parts Specialists to ensure seamless service for internal and external customers.
  • Document all work performed with accuracy and attention to detail.
  • Stay up to date on GM certifications, training, and evolving technologies.
  • Contribute to a team environment focused on quality, efficiency, and customer satisfaction.
Qualifications
  • ASE Certification preferred.
  • 3+ years of Service Technician experience required.
  • A-level qualifications in Diagnostic, Electrical, and Engine Repair.
  • Broad knowledge of new vehicle technologies.
  • Ambitious, hardworking presence in a team environment.
  • Excellent customer service skills.
  • Basic computer skills.
  • Positive, friendly attitude and customer service mentality.
  • Enjoy working in a dynamic environment.
  • Ability to collaborate effectively.
  • Ability to learn new technology, repair and service procedures and specifications.
  • Able to operate electronic diagnostic equipment.
  • Minimum high school diploma or GED equivalent required.
  • Valid driver's license.
